三元股份上半年营收33.31亿元 持续深化改革效果显著
Zheng Quan Ri Bao Zhi Sheng· 2025-09-02 11:45
Core Viewpoint - Beijing Sanyuan Foods Co., Ltd. has reported a solid performance in the first half of 2025, achieving a net profit growth of 43% despite a 13.77% decline in revenue, demonstrating a focus on profitable income and cash flow [1][3]. Financial Performance - The company achieved an operating income of 3.331 billion yuan, a decrease of 13.77% year-on-year [1]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ders was 183 million yuan, an increase of 43% year-on-year [1]. - The net profit after deducting non-recurring items was 174 million yuan, up 66% year-on-year [1]. Business Strategy - Sanyuan Foods emphasized its commitment to core business operations and integrated party building with production management, leading to improved operational quality and efficiency [1]. - The company focused on organizational reform, talent allocation, and mechanism optimization to enhance team effectiveness [3][6]. Product and Sales Breakdown - Sales revenue by product category included liquid milk at 1.993 billion yuan, solid milk at 453 million yuan, and ice cream at 780 million yuan [2]. - Direct sales channel revenue reached 1.351 billion yuan, reflecting a 14.1% increase from the previous year [5]. - Revenue from the Beijing region was 1.406 billion yuan, while revenue from outside Beijing was 1.821 billion yuan [2]. Market Context - The Chinese dairy industry is undergoing a cyclical adjustment, with rational consumption patterns emerging and consumers increasingly focused on product value [2]. - The overall dairy product market is experiencing challenges, with 11 out of 19 listed dairy companies reporting a decline in revenue for the first half of 2025 [2]. Innovation and Development - Sanyuan Foods is committed to enhancing product quality and expanding its market presence through innovation and digital transformation [6]. - The company has invested 37.56 million yuan in research and development, maintaining a high level of investment compared to previous years [6]. Future Outlook - Experts suggest that Sanyuan Foods should leverage its strengths in research and innovation to break into the functional nutrition market, given the shift in consumer preferences [7].
